How much do research and development ass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 23, 2026, the average hourly pay for research and development assistant in Massachusetts is $23.84,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.18 and $26.25 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a research and development assistant?

Research and Development Assistants are professionals who support R&D teams in creating, testing, and improving products or processes. Their duties often include conducting experiments, collecting and analyzing data, preparing reports, and maintaining laboratory equipment. They work in a variety of industries, such as pharmaceuticals, technology, and manufacturing, and play a vital role in ensuring that new ideas move from concept to reality efficiently and accurately. R&D Assistants help streamline research processes and support innovation within organizations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a research and development assistant?

To thrive as a Research and Development Assistant, you need a solid background in scientific research methods, data analysis, and a relevant degree such as in chemistry, biology, or engineering. Familiarity with laboratory equipment, data analysis software, and compliance with safety protocols is typically required.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ication help you excel in collaborative and fast-paced research environments. These competencies ensure accurate data collection, efficient project support, and contribute to successful innovation and product development.

What are some common challenges faced by research and development assistants, and how can they be managed effectively?

Research and Development Assistants often face challenges such as managing tight project deadlines, adapting to rapidly changing priorities, and handling large volumes of data or experimental results. Effective time management, strong organizational skills, and clear communication with team members can help address these challenges. Collaborating closely with scientists and engineers, regularly updating progress, and seeking feedback are also essential for ensuring projects stay on track and deliver quality results.

The Administrative Assistant will provide essential logistical and organizational support to the Research Development team within Boston Universitys Office of Research. This position reports to the Director of Research Development and serves as a key resource for ensuring smooth operations and effective communication within the Research Development unit. The Administrative Assistant will manage the Research Development inbox, triaging inquiries and ensuring timely responses and follow-up. The position requires coordinating and maintaining the Director of Research Development's calendar, including scheduling and prioritizing meetings and commitments. The assistant will organize and maintain RD shared drives and file structures to ensure clear, consistent, and accessible document management across the unit. The position includes planning and coordinating meetings, events, and webinars, managing logistics such as scheduling, materials preparation, room reservations, and virtual setup. The assistant will support visits and engagements with external partners and guests, including coordinating space, catering, and on-site logistics to facilitate productive meetings and partnerships. The Administrative Assistant will process reimbursements and manage purchasing activities for the RD team, including tracking expenses on departmental or company cards. Additionally, the position involves tracking and managing Office of Research subscriptions, including monitoring renewals, pricing, and vendor communications to ensure cost-effective resource management.

Boston University is an international, comprehensive, private research university, committed to educating students to be reflective, resourceful individuals ready to live, adapt, and lead in an interconnected world. Boston University is committed to generating new knowledge to benefit society. We remain dedicated to our founding principles: that higher education should be accessible to all and that research, scholarship, artistic creation, and professional practice should be conducted in the service of the wider community—local and international. These principles endure in the University’s insistence on the value of diversity, in its tradition and standards of excellence, and in its dynamic engagement with the City of Boston and the world. Boston University comprises a remarkable range of undergraduate, graduate, and professional programs built on a strong foundation of the liberal arts and sciences. With the support and oversight of the Board of Trustees, the University, through our faculty, continually innovates in education and research to ensure that we meet the needs of students and an ever-changing world.
